Рейтинг:0

Как применить несколько меток к узлам jenkins?

флаг cn

Когда я применяю метку к узлу, он работает, как и ожидалось, и задание может выбрать этот узел.

Но если я применяю несколько меток, это не работает. Как я наблюдаю, он воспринимает их обоих как один ярлык.

Пример: лейбл: devbuild

Это работа с работой.

Но,

метка: devbuild, installernode

Он не работает ни для одного из заданий с меткой «devbuild» или «installernode». Даже я пытался с ; но такая же проблема.

Пожалуйста, предложите, как применить несколько меток к одному узлу.

флаг ba
Это пространство, разделенное. [Условия метки] (https://www.jenkins.io/doc/book/pipeline/syntax/) также можно использовать. Например: `agent { label 'my-label1 && my-label2' }` или `agent { label 'my-label1 || моя метка2' }`. Это было бы на стороне работы.
Рейтинг:0
флаг jp

В моем экземпляре Jenkins метки узлов разделены пробелами (не запятыми и не точками с запятой). Так:

узел установки devbuild

Должен работать на вас.

Sara June avatar
флаг cn
Ага заметил, спасибо.

Ответить или комментировать

Большинство людей не понимают, что склонность к познанию нового открывает путь к обучению и улучшает межличностные связи. В исследованиях Элисон, например, хотя люди могли точно вспомнить, сколько вопросов было задано в их разговорах, они не чувствовали интуитивно связи между вопросами и симпатиями. В четырех исследованиях, в которых участники сами участвовали в разговорах или читали стенограммы чужих разговоров, люди, как правило, не осознавали, что задаваемый вопрос повлияет — или повлиял — на уровень дружбы между собеседниками.